450 steps, manageable with 3-4 stops along the way - rewarded with incredible views! - An incredible opportunity to learn about the history of the Novara and to take in some INCREDIBLE views! Highly recommending booking tickets online, in advance. The climb is accompanied by two guides - and don't worry - even though there are 450 small, winding, vertical steps --it is done in stages! There are about 3-4 "stops" on the way up to learn about the history of each of the successive domes, the architecture , the architect etc! Pack light - the only thing you are allowed to take up is your phone - which they will encase in a protective plastic covering to wear around your neck. There are lockers available at check in to store a purse or small backpack. And the views - just get better and better the higher you climb. Highly recommend.
